Output 37e97058c151be6ef62f04d7dae068b3ab36a6cc052e121602fd6ea7f7f08312:2

value
312279523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fbd1532058d641d2daed326f9b97bf6a9f27dea OP_EQUAL
address
MAnyh5akGXhc5qJz7HEnwauU9QZoS44hS2
transaction
37e97058c151be6ef62f04d7dae068b3ab36a6cc052e121602fd6ea7f7f08312
spent
true